Location is one of the most critical choices for engaged couples planning their weddings since so much about a wedding – from the number of guests to the actual date – depends on the location.

Where Do Celebrities Get Married?

When the rich and famous marry, they often select venues that offer an ideal balance of luxury and privacy from the paparazzi. If you’re planning your nuptials and need inspiration or are curious, look no further than these fantasy wedding venues.

1. Alila Ventana Big Sur, Big Sur, California

Surrounded by mountains, forest lands, and the Pacific coastline, the Alila Ventana Big Sur in Big Sur, California, has multiple gorgeous settings to take any wedding ceremony to the next level. The estate has romantic shade arbors, terraces, and ample green spaces perfect for photos. Alila Ventana Big Sur was the chosen venue for the 2012 wedding of actress Anne Hathaway.

2. Borgo Egnazia, Puglia, Italy

A small village unto itself, Borgo Egnazia is a five-star resort in southern Italy. This hidden gem in the Mediterranean is where Jessica Biel and Justin Timberlake were married. Borgo Egnazia comprises white limestone buildings framed by lush olive trees and the Ionian Sea.

Wedding couples and their guests can rent stays in entire villas or individual rooms and participate in activities such as olive oil and wine tastings, golf, fishing, and cooking classes.

3. The Breakers Resort, Palm Beach, Florida

Boasting a unique 12 indoor and outdoor locations for weddings and receptions, The Breakers Resort is one of the most versatile sites in the world. Equipped with spectacular ballrooms, manicured lawns, views of the ocean, and a Mediterranean-style courtyard, it’s no surprise The Breakers is a sought-after destination.

Famous people who have married at the resort include John F. and Jackie Kennedy, Sofia Vergara and Joe Manganiello, Elton John, and Henry James.

4. Château de Tourreau, Sarrians, France

Nestled in the Provence region in the south of France, the Château de Tourreau was the site of the formal wedding ceremony of Sophie Turner and Joe Jonas after they married in Las Vegas.

The quaint 17th-century palace is on a 20-acre estate with a consecrated chapel. The site has numerous outdoor features, such as an organic garden, orchards, fountains, an infinity pool, and indoor amenities, including nine suites, six dining rooms, and a library.

5. Flora Farm, Los Cabos, Mexico

What distinguishes the site of singer Adam Levine’s 2014 wedding to Victoria’s Secret model Behati Prinsloo from other destination weddings is that Flora Farm is an actual working farm with a farm-to-table restaurant. Betrothed couples can tie the knot inside the Mango Grove barn or the outside herb garden amphitheater bordered with crops, plants, and flowers.

6. Greyfield Inn, Cumberland Island, Georgia

After marrying privately at the First African Baptist Church in 1996, John F. Kennedy, Jr. and Carolyn Bessette held their reception at the historic Greyfield Inn. Constructed in the 1800s, the 200-acre undeveloped estate is between the beach and marshland.

The Inn is famous for merging luxury hotel amenities with the feel of being at home. Wedding ceremonies occur in the formal dining room or the front lawn, with outdoor receptions under a canopy of oak trees.

7. Luttrellstown Castle, Dublin, Ireland

This private estate on the outskirts of Dublin is a dream venue for weddings and receptions. It has a 20-bedroom ancestral castle dating back to the 15th century and a three-story chalet clubhouse available for indoor and outdoor weddings and receptions. The incredible greenery and lavish ballrooms were the backdrops of the 1996 wedding of David and Victoria Beckham.

8. Montage Palmetto Bluff Hotel, Bluffton, South Carolina

A secluded resort north of Savannah, Georgia, the Montage Palmetto Bluff Hotel consists of two idyllic villages, each with a wedding chapel and ballroom. Bridal couples and their guests can visit the riverfront marina and nature preserve or play one or two rounds of golf at the Jack Nicklaus Signature Golf Course. This resort hosted the 2018 nuptials of Justin and Hailey Bieber.

9. Ritz Carlton Maui Kapalua, Maui, Hawaii

The natural beauty of the Maui, Hawaii resort makes it a popular destination wedding site for celebrity couples like Miles Teller and Kayleigh Sperry and non-celebrity couples. The breathtaking views of the Maui landscape and oceanfront, multiple indoor and outdoor venues, and an on-staff wedding planner are just a few of the attractions.

10. San Ysidro Ranch, Montecito, California

Celebrity couples like Chris Pratt and Katherine Schwarzenegger opted for a wedding venue with a modern rustic feel, which they achieved at the San Ysidro Ranch. Located at the Santa Ynez Mountains base, the picturesque 500-acre estate with orange and lemon trees overlooks the Pacific Ocean.
